Now, Enjoy KFC’s ‘finger licking’ Meals On Trains

kfc

After Dominos, World’s largest chicken restaurant chain Kentucky Fried Chicken (KFC) has reached an agreement with the Indian Railway Catering and Tourism Corporation (IRCTC) to be at the service of passengers on trains.

Currently, KFC’s service is available on 12 trains passing through New Delhi railway station. The service will be expanded to stations such as Kacheguda (Hyderabad), Visakhapatnam and Yeshwantpur (Bengaluru) in a span of 10 days. All that consumers have to do is to visit the official website of IRCTC or dial the toll free number to place an order.

In India, About 1.3 crore people travel on trains per day and hence leading Fast Food Chains competing to offer their services to passengers. They, however, have to deal with issues like late arrival of trains and prompt delivery.

Dominos which began its operations in February this year has expanded its service to 200 trains but the down side is managing to sell just 350-odd Pizzas until now. IRCTC is already holding talks with other food chains such as Pizza Hut & Subway.
